Key Industrial Clusters for Bicycle Manufacturing in China
Bicycle manufacturing in China is concentrated in several industrial hubs, each specializing in different segments of the market—from mass-market commuter bikes to high-end e-bikes and carbon fiber frames. The following provinces and cities represent the core production clusters:
1. Tianjin (Northern China)
- Hub City: Tianjin Municipality (particularly Jinghai District)
- Specialization: Entry-level and mid-range bicycles, children’s bikes, and folding bikes.
- Key Factories: Giant (subsidiary operations), Tianjin Dafa, Flying Pigeon, Forever.
- Export Volume: ~35% of China’s total bicycle exports.
- Logistics Advantage: Proximity to Beijing and Tianjin Port (one of China’s busiest export gateways).
2. Guangdong Province (Southern China)
- Hub Cities: Dongguan, Shenzhen, Guangzhou
- Specialization: High-end e-bikes, smart bikes, OEM/ODM for European and North American brands.
- Key Factories: Tailing, Yadea (e-bike leader), Sunra, smaller agile e-bike innovators.
- Technology Edge: Strong integration with electronics supply chains (batteries, motors, IoT components).
- Export Focus: EU, USA, Australia.
3. Zhejiang Province (Eastern China)
- Hub Cities: Wenzhou, Ningbo, Hangzhou
- Specialization: Mid-to-high-end folding bikes, mountain bikes, and aluminum frame production.
- Key Factories: Zhejiang Luyue, Joyride, Zhejiang Feige.
- Quality Benchmark: Strong adherence to ISO and EN standards; many ISO 9001-certified suppliers.
- Logistics: Access to Ningbo-Zhoushan Port (world’s busiest by cargo tonnage).
4. Jiangsu Province (Eastern China)
- Hub Cities: Changzhou, Wuxi
- Specialization: E-bike systems, lithium-ion battery integration, premium commuter models.
- Innovation Hub: Home to numerous R&D centers and battery technology firms.
- Key Players: Xinri, Ampera, local OEM partners for European brands.

1. Market Overview: China Bicycle Manufacturing Landscape
China hosts over 1,200 bicycle manufacturers, primarily concentrated in Tianjin, Guangdong, Zhejiang, and Hebei. These regions offer integrated supply chains for frames, drivetrains, wheels, and electronics (for e-bikes). The industry supports both traditional and e-bike production, with advanced capabilities in aluminum/carbon fiber frames, smart integration, and modular design.
Key advantages:
– Mature supply chain ecosystems
– Competitive labor and material costs
– Scalable OEM/ODM infrastructure
– Compliance with EU, U.S., and ISO standards
2. OEM vs. ODM: Strategic Considerations
| Model | Description | Best For | Control Level | Development Cost |
|---|---|---|---|---|
| OEM (Original Equipment Manufacturing) | Manufacturer produces bicycles to your exact specifications and branding | Brands with established designs | High (full design control) | Medium to High |
| ODM (Original Design Manufacturing) | Manufacturer provides pre-designed models that can be rebranded | Fast time-to-market, lower R&D | Low to Medium (limited customization) | Low |
Recommendation: Use ODM for entry-level or urban commuter models to reduce time-to-market. Use OEM for performance or premium e-bike lines to ensure brand differentiation.
3. White Label vs. Private Label: Branding Strategy
| Feature | White Label | Private Label |
|---|---|---|
| Definition | Generic product sold under multiple brands with minimal customization | Fully customized product with exclusive branding and design |
| Customization | Limited (logos, colors) | High (frame geometry, components, packaging) |
| MOQ | Low (500–1,000 units) | Medium to High (1,000–5,000+ units) |
| Lead Time | 30–45 days | 60–90 days |
| IP Ownership | Shared or none | Full ownership (with OEM) |
| Best Use Case | Budget retail chains, rental fleets | Branded retail, DTC e-commerce |
Strategic Insight: Private label enhances brand equity and margins but requires higher investment. White label is ideal for testing markets or volume-driven B2B sales.
4. Estimated Cost Breakdown (Per Unit, 26″ Hybrid Bike)
| Cost Component | Description | Estimated Cost (USD) |
|---|---|---|
| Frame & Fork | Aluminum alloy, welded & painted | $35–$50 |
| Drivetrain | Shimano Tourney or equivalent | $20–$30 |
| Wheels & Tires | Double-wall rims, 26″x1.95 tires | $25–$35 |
| Brakes & Handlebars | Mechanical disc brakes, alloy stem/handlebar | $15–$20 |
| Saddle & Seat Post | Comfort saddle, adjustable post | $8–$12 |
| Labor (Assembly & QA) | Final assembly, testing, packaging | $12–$18 |
| Packaging | Corrugated box, foam inserts, manual | $6–$10 |
| Overhead & Profit Margin | Factory overhead, export logistics | $10–$15 |
| Total Estimated Cost | $131–$190 |
Note: Costs vary based on component quality, e-bike integration (+$150–$400), and customization level.
5. Price Tiers by MOQ (FOB China, Hybrid Bike)
| MOQ | Unit Price (USD) | Total Cost (USD) | Remarks |
|---|---|---|---|
| 500 units | $185 – $220 | $92,500 – $110,000 | White label or light private label; limited customization |
| 1,000 units | $165 – $195 | $165,000 – $195,000 | Standard private label; moderate customization |
| 5,000 units | $145 – $170 | $725,000 – $850,000 | Full private label; design exclusivity, better packaging options |
Notes:
– Prices exclude shipping, duties, and import taxes.
– E-bike models start at $399/unit (MOQ 1,000) and scale down to $320/unit at 5,000 units.
– Color-matching, custom decals, and branded packaging add $2–$5/unit.

Trading Company vs. Factory: Key Differentiators
70% of “bicycle manufacturers” on Alibaba are intermediaries (SourcifyChina 2025 Data)
| Indicator | Genuine Factory | Trading Company | Verification Method |
|---|---|---|---|
| Company Name | Includes “Co., Ltd.” + “Manufacturing” (e.g., 永康市XX制造有限公司) | Generic name (e.g., “Global Bike Supply”) | Cross-check business license registration |
| Production Evidence | Shows raw material inventory (aluminum billets, carbon sheets) | Only displays finished bikes in warehouse | Live video of raw material storage area |
| Pricing Structure | Quotes FOB terms + itemized BOM costs | Quotes EXW with vague cost breakdown | Demand component-level cost analysis |
| Minimum Order Quantity | MOQ ≥ 500 units (frame-dependent) | MOQ < 200 units (standardized models) | Test flexibility for custom geometry |
| Engineering Capability | Provides CAD drawings of custom frames | Offers only catalog models | Request design revision for sample order |
